“for the first time” in rule 5 (1).[5] Rule 12 Conversion of temporary or term employment to ongoing employment at-level
Omit rule 12 (1). Insert instead:
(1) An agency head may convert the temporary or term employment of a person
to ongoing employment in the agency if:
(a) the ongoing employment is at-level, and (b)
the person has been employed in that temporary or term employment for a period of at least 12 months.
(1A) The requirement under subrule (1) (b) applies only if the advertisement for the temporary or term employment did not refer to the availability or potential availability of ongoing employment. [6] Rule 12 (2) (a)

Insert after rule 12 (8):
(9) A reference in this rule to the head of the agency in which a person is employed is, in the case where the person is a Public Service senior executive, taken to be a reference to the employer of the executive.
[9] Rule 21 Temporary or term employment for up to 12 months
Omit “6 months” from rule 21 (1) and (2) wherever occurring. Insert instead “12 months”.
[10] Rule 21 (2)
Omit “3 months”. Insert instead “9 months”.
[11] Rule 22 Temporary or term employment for more than 12 months
Omit “6 months” from rule 22 (1). Insert instead “12 months”.
